首页
/ AI编程助手使用优化:突破限制与提升开发效率的完整解决方案

AI编程助手使用优化:突破限制与提升开发效率的完整解决方案

2026-04-29 10:51:16作者:平淮齐Percy

在当今软件开发领域,AI编程助手已成为提升开发效率的关键工具。然而,许多开发者在使用过程中面临各种限制,影响了工作流的连续性和效率。本文将系统介绍AI编程助手优化的技术方案,帮助开发者突破使用限制,实现开发效率提升方案的全面落地。

问题诊断:AI编程助手使用限制深度分析

AI编程助手的使用限制往往源于多重技术机制的综合作用,理解这些限制的本质是实施有效优化的前提。本节将从设备识别、授权验证和资源管控三个维度剖析限制产生的技术根源。

设备身份绑定机制解析

机器标识技术原理:AI编程助手通过机器ID(Machine ID)识别设备唯一性,这是一种基于硬件特征和系统配置生成的唯一标识符。当系统检测到同一设备频繁创建或切换账户时,会触发使用限制机制。

操作系统 机器ID存储路径 技术特征
Windows %AppData%\Roaming\Cursor\machineId 基于系统硬件UUID和用户配置生成
macOS ~/Library/Application Support/Cursor/machineId 结合硬盘序列号和系统版本信息
Linux ~/.config/cursor/machineid 基于主板信息和用户目录哈希

授权验证流程分析

授权验证是确保软件使用合规性的关键环节,但复杂的验证逻辑也可能成为限制合理使用的瓶颈。典型的验证流程包括本地授权文件校验、远程服务器状态确认和使用行为模式分析三个阶段。当任一环节检测到异常,系统会自动触发限制机制。

AI助手配置界面 图1:AI编程助手授权管理界面,显示账户信息和核心功能选项

方案设计:AI编程助手优化技术架构

基于对限制机制的深入分析,我们设计了一套完整的技术优化方案,通过设备标识重置、多账户管理和授权流程优化三大核心模块,实现对AI编程助手使用限制的有效突破。

智能设备标识重置系统

设备标识重置是突破设备绑定限制的核心技术,通过安全生成新的机器ID,使系统将当前设备识别为"新设备",从而解除之前的使用限制。该方案采用安全的ID生成算法,确保新ID的有效性和唯一性。

多账户管理解决方案

为满足不同场景下的使用需求,系统提供灵活的账户管理策略,支持临时邮箱注册、自定义邮箱配置和第三方账号集成等多种账户创建方式,实现账户资源的高效利用。

多账户管理界面 图2:多账户管理界面,展示不同类型账户的注册选项和使用状态

账户类型 特点 适用场景
临时邮箱账户 快速创建,自动销毁 短期测试和临时使用
自定义邮箱账户 长期稳定,可找回 主要开发环境
第三方关联账户 便捷登录,高安全性 多设备同步使用

实施指南:环境适配与配置步骤

成功实施AI编程助手优化方案需要遵循标准化的操作流程,从环境准备到功能验证,每个环节都有其关键操作要点和注意事项。本节将详细介绍完整的实施步骤。

环境兼容性检测

在实施优化方案前,需要确保系统环境满足基本要求,避免因环境不兼容导致的功能异常。环境检测主要包括操作系统版本验证、依赖组件检查和权限配置确认三个方面。

  1. 操作系统版本检查

    • Windows系统需确认Windows 10 1809以上版本
    • macOS需验证macOS 12.0+版本
    • Linux系统需确认内核版本4.15以上
  2. 依赖组件安装

    # Ubuntu/Debian系统
    sudo apt update && sudo apt install -y python3 python3-pip
    
    # CentOS/RHEL系统
    sudo yum install -y python3 python3-pip
    
    # macOS系统
    brew install python3
    
  3. 权限配置确认

    • 确保当前用户对AI编程助手配置目录有读写权限
    • 验证Python环境可正常执行网络请求

详细实施步骤

以下是优化方案的完整实施流程,按照操作顺序分为工具准备、配置优化和功能验证三个阶段:

  1. 工具获取与准备

    git clone https://gitcode.com/GitHub_Trending/cu/cursor-free-vip
    cd cursor-free-vip
    pip3 install -r requirements.txt
    

    注意事项:确保网络连接正常,能够访问Gitcode仓库和Python包管理服务器

  2. 配置优化与执行

    # 启动配置向导
    python3 main.py
    
    # 根据界面提示完成以下操作:
    # 1. 选择"Reset Machine ID"选项
    # 2. 选择合适的账户注册方式
    # 3. 启用"Disable Auto-Update"功能
    # 4. 配置"ByPass Token Limit"选项
    

    注意事项:执行过程中需关闭AI编程助手主程序,确保配置文件可被修改

  3. 功能验证与确认

    • 重新启动AI编程助手
    • 检查账户状态是否显示为"Pro"
    • 验证高级功能是否可正常使用
    • 测试连续使用是否触发限制提示

配置执行状态 图3:配置优化执行过程,显示机器ID重置和Pro状态保持情况

优化策略:长期使用维护与安全保障

为确保优化方案的长期稳定运行,需要建立完善的维护策略和安全保障机制,平衡功能优化与系统安全,实现可持续的高效使用体验。

长期使用维护策略

长期稳定使用需要关注工具更新、配置备份和异常监控三个方面,建立常态化的维护机制:

  1. 工具版本管理

    • 定期检查工具更新:python3 main.py --check-update
    • 重要更新前备份当前配置:python3 main.py --backup-config
    • 建立版本回滚机制,保留稳定版本
  2. 使用状态监控

    • 定期查看使用统计:python3 main.py --show-usage
    • 设置使用量预警,避免触发异常检测
    • 监控授权状态,及时发现授权异常
维护项目 周期 操作方式
版本更新检查 每周一次 自动检查+手动确认
配置备份 每月一次 全量备份+增量备份
使用状态分析 每日一次 自动生成使用报告
系统兼容性检测 每季度一次 环境配置扫描

数据安全与合规提示

在享受优化方案带来便利的同时,需重视数据安全和合规使用,采取必要的防护措施:

  1. 数据保护措施

    • 避免在公共网络环境下执行配置操作
    • 定期清理临时账户信息,避免信息残留
    • 敏感操作在离线环境下进行
  2. 合规使用建议

    • 了解并遵守软件使用许可协议
    • 仅在授权范围内使用优化功能
    • 尊重知识产权,合理使用AI生成内容

高级功能配置界面 图4:高级功能配置界面,展示长期使用优化选项和安全设置

通过实施上述优化方案和维护策略,开发者可以有效突破AI编程助手的使用限制,同时确保系统安全和长期稳定运行。优化后的AI编程助手将成为提升开发效率的强大工具,为软件开发工作流带来实质性改进。建议用户根据自身使用场景,灵活调整配置选项,找到最适合自己的使用模式。

登录后查看全文
热门项目推荐
相关项目推荐